How they compare
Netherlands currently reports 120 Number against 90 Number in Austria, a difference of 30 Number.
That makes Netherlands's figure about 1.3 times Austria's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 17 shared years of data; in 2008 it was Netherlands ahead.
Austria ranks 12th and Netherlands ranks 9th of 45 countries.
Netherlands has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Austria | Netherlands |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 140.5 Number | 152 Number | 11.5 Number | Netherlands |
| 2010s | 65.6 Number | 123.5 Number | 57.9 Number | Netherlands |
| 2020s | 78.8 Number | 127.8 Number | 49 Number | Netherlands |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
